Mark Grayson is a normal teenager except for the fact that his father is the most powerful superhero on the planet. Shortly after his seventeenth birthday, Mark begins to develop powers of his own and enters into his father’s tutelage.

#10 - THIS MUST COME AS A SHOCK (Season 2 - Episode 5)

The Grayson household is upended when Mark returns to Earth with surprising new responsibilities. The Guardians of the Globe face dangers both at home and away.

The episode was rated 8.14 from 554 votes.

#6 - IT'S NOT THAT SIMPLE (Season 2 - Episode 6)

After two challenging missions, the Guardians of the Globe struggle to work as a team. Meanwhile, Mark tries to balance his hero duties, personal relationships, and his future as a college student.

The episode was rated 7.78 from 440 votes.
